tde encryption oracle 19c step by step
It is no longer required to include the "file_name_convert" clause. There are two ways to do it, (a) Generate the Master key using Single command. Please note that, I know you could have considered putting wallet in ASM, a shared space for it, but I think wallet in ASM is pretty hard to mange and migrate to another place, e.g. I did all the following operations on node 2 purposely to verify the wallet copying is working. Oracle Database uses authentication, authorization, and auditing mechanisms to secure data in the database, but not in the operating system data files where data is stored. Oracle Database Articles & Cloud Tutorials. Oracle E-Business Suite Technology Stack - Version 12.2 and later: 19c DBUA TDE-Encrypted Database Upgrade Fails During Timezone Step with ORA-600 [kcbtse_encdec_tb 19c DBUA TDE-Encrypted Database Upgrade Fails During Timezone Step with ORA-600 [kcbtse_encdec_tbsblk_11] in alert.log Steps by Step Transparent Data Encryption (TDE) column-level encryption in Oracle E-Business Suite (EBS) R12 environment. Data is safe (some tools dont encrypt by default). Oracle Database Articles & Cloud Tutorials, Click to share on Twitter (Opens in new window), Click to share on Facebook (Opens in new window), Click to share on LinkedIn (Opens in new window), Click to share on WhatsApp (Opens in new window), Click to share on Skype (Opens in new window), How to use TDE Encryption for Database Export in Oracle, ORA-04031: unable to allocate bytes of shared memory during oracle startup, How to Gather Statistics on Large Partitioned Tables in Oracle, How select statement works internally in oracle, RMAN-06817: Pluggable Database cannot be backed up in NOARCHIVELOG mode, VI editor shows the error Terminal too wide within Solaris, 30 Important Linux Commands With Examples. [oracle@Prod22 admin]$ cat sqlnet.ora, ENCRYPTION_WALLET_LOCATION= To perform import and export operations, use Oracle Data Pump. Starting with Oracle Database 11g Release 2 Patchset 1 (11.2.0.2), the hardware crypto acceleration based on AES-NI available in recent Intel processors is automatically leveraged by TDE tablespace encryption, making TDE tablespace encryption a 'near-zero impact' encryption solution. Some application vendors do a deeper integration and provide TDE configuration steps using their own toolkits. Restart the database and try to access the table which we created in step 7. clprod.env, Total System Global Area 16106127360 bytes. For the tablespaces created before this setup, you can do an online encryption. All the encryption is done at the files level, transparent for the application. select 385000000 + level 1, GSMB For any Oracle instance running in a VM managed (Azure, OCI, or AWS) by you, the above steps are still valid. STEP 1: Create pfile from spfile in below location. encrypt file_name_convert =(/u02/app/oracle/oradata/ORADBWR/tde_tbs1.dbf,/u02/app/oracle/oradata/ORADBWR/tde_tbs1_encrypted.dbf); TDE is fully integrated with the Oracle database. This approach includes certain restrictions described in Oracle Database 12c product documentation. This option is the default. if we have a standby it should have the same wallet as Primary. The TDE full form is transparent data encryption. For more details on BYOK,please see the Advanced Security Guideunder Security on the Oracle Database product documentation that is availablehere. Notify me of follow-up comments by email. [oracle@Prod22 ~]$ . For separation of duties, these commands are accessible only to security administrators who hold the new SYSKM administrative privilege or higher. The process of encryption and decryption adds additional . 1 oracle oinstall 1038098432 Jun 21 21:21 system01.dbf 2. 3.3.5 Step 4: Set the TDE Master Encryption Key in the Software Keystore . Reboot the database and try again the query. Individual table columns that are encrypted using TDE column encryption will have a much lower level of compression because the encryption takes place in the SQL layer before the advanced compression process. Oracle recommends that you use the WALLET_ROOT static initialization parameter and TDE_CONFIGURATION dynamic initialization parameter instead. Disconnected from Oracle Database 19c Enterprise Edition Release 19.0.0.0.0 Production GSMB, Transparent Data Encryption (TDE) enables you to encrypt sensitive data that you store in tables and tablespaces. OEM 13.4 - Step by Step Installing Oracle Enterprise Manager Cloud Control 13c Release 4 on Oracle Linux 8.2 - Part 2 1 oracle oinstall 692068352 Jun 21 21:26 sysaux01.dbf In this article we will discuss about enabling Transparent Data Encryption - TDE in Oracle 19c. After issuing the command above SQL Server will suspend the asynchronous encryption process. We can set the master encryption key by executing the following statement: Copy code snippet. Using Transparent Data Encryption in Oracle Database 11g Prepare Wallet for Node 2. Once TDE is configured on the data, only the authorized users can access this data. . Enable TDE Tablespace encryption in an Oracle 19c Instance Create Keystores. BANNER -rw-r. Before we can set the TDE master key in the keystore, we should open it. Customers using TDE tablespace encryption get the full benefit of compression (standard and Advanced Compression, as well as Exadata Hybrid Columnar Compression (EHCC)) because compression is applied before the data blocks are encrypted. Considerations for Converting Single-Instance Databases to Oracle RAC 3-22 Scenario 1: Using DBCA 3-23 Step 1: Create an Image of the Single-Instance Database 3-24 Example: Result of Step 1 3-25 Step 2: Create an Oracle Cluster for RAC 3-26 Example: Result of Step 2 3-27 Step 3: Copy the Preconfigured Database Image 3-28 Prepare Wallet for Node 2. In fact, for databases in the Oracle Cloud, TDE is ON by default with no configuration needed. Since that time, it has become progressively simpler to deploy. Your email address will not be published. Database Buffers 2466250752 bytes It stops unauthorized attempts by the operating system to access database data stored in files, without impacting how applications access the data using SQL. Recreate temp tspace in cdb Step 11. In Oracle Autonomous Databases and Database Cloud Services it is included, configured, and enabled by default. In this blog post we are going to have a step by step instruction to Enable Transparent Data Encryption (TDE). If you have any benchmark about comparing those algorithm, please comment your thinking below. After the data is encrypted, it is transparently decrypted for authorized users or applications when accessed. 1 oracle oinstall 68165632 Jun 21 20:41 temp01.dbf In this post, I will discuss about enabling Transparent Data Encryption TDE in Oracle 19c. A variety of helpful information is available on this page including product data sheet, customer references, videos, tutorials, and more. Also, see here for up-to-date summary information regarding Oracle Database certifications and validations. For more best practices for your specific Oracle Database version,please see the Advanced Security Guideunder Security on the Oracle Database product documentation that is availablehere. SQL> shut immediate RRC - Oracle Database Administrator III - V (100% remote in Texas) STEP 2: Configure the Keystore Location and Type, STEP 5: Configure Auto Login Keystore and check the status, STEP 7: Set the Keystore TDE Encryption Master Key. Setting up TDE (Transparent Data Encryption) in 19c is very easy and these are the steps needed. Oracle Exadata - Huge Pages - In the context of Exadata - Oracle Linux [oracle@dev19c ~]$ sqlplus / as sysdba. -rw-r. . Take file backup of wallet files ewallet.p12 and cwallet.sso in standby DB. If you would like to change your settings or withdraw consent at any time, the link to do so is in our privacy policy accessible from our home page.. Once the DB is restored please make sure to rekey the wallet on the target side and delete the older master keys. 1 oracle oinstall 2555 Jun 21 19:12 ewallet_2021062113423541_TDE_backup.p12 Transparent Data Encryption (TDE) encrypts database files to secure your data. Version 19.11.0.0.0 With the WALLET_ROOT parameter, the wallet will be stored in subdirectory name tde. ENCRYPT_NEW_TABLESPACES parameter specifies whether the new tablespaces to be created should be implicitly encrypted. document.getElementById("ak_js_1").setAttribute("value",(new Date()).getTime()); if(typeof ez_ad_units!='undefined'){ez_ad_units.push([[320,100],'techgoeasy_com-large-billboard-2','ezslot_9',129,'0','0'])};__ez_fad_position('div-gpt-ad-techgoeasy_com-large-billboard-2-0');report this ad, Enter your email address to subscribe to this blog and receive notifications of new posts by email, TDE encryption in Oracle 12c step by step. Auto-login keystore is enabling and working, we should additionally check the encrypted data. -rw-r. The TDE master encryption key is stored in an external security module (software or hardware keystore). Moreover, tablespace encryption in particular leverages hardware-based crypto acceleration where it is available, minimizing the performance impact even further to the near-zero range. 1 oracle oinstall 52436992 Jun 21 21:29 tde_tbs1_encrypted.dbf ALTER SYSTEM SET WALLET_ROOT='C:\ORACLE\admin\cdb1\wallet' SCOPE=SPFILE SID='*'; --Shutdown immediate and Startup before set run following command --No need to reboot ALTER . Oracle TDE implementation in Oracle 21c step by step - shripal singh Begining with Oracle Database 18c, you can create a user-defined master encryption keyinstead of requiring that TDE master encryption keys always be generated in the database. To prevent unauthorized decryption, TDE stores the encryption keys in a security module external to the database, called a keystore. Support for Secure File LOBs is a core feature of the database, Oracle Database package encryption toolkit (DBMS_CRYPTO) for encrypting database columns using PL/SQL, Oracle Java (JCA/JCE), application tier encryption may limit certain query functionality of the database. TDE provides multiple techniques to migrate existing clear data to encrypted tablespaces or columns. #OracleF1 #Oracle19c #OracleTDE #TransparentDataEncryptionHow to Configure TDE in Oracle 19c Standalone Database in Oracle Linux 7.9In this video, I demonstr. It is available as an additional licensed option for the Oracle Database Enterprise Edition. No, it is not possible to plug-in other encryption algorithms. Due the latest advances in chipsets that accelerate encrypt/decrypt operations, evolving regulatory landscape, and the ever evolving concept of what data is considered to be sensitive, most customers are opting to encrypt all application data using tablespace encryption and storing the master encryption key in Oracle Key Vault. NOTE - Don't implement this on production database. TDE can encrypt entire application tablespaces or specific sensitive columns. If you import this data into an encrypted tablespace, it will be encrypted, if you import into an unencrypted tablespace, then the data will be unencrypted. Fixed Size 8900864 bytes Step #1 Create a master key. We should restart the database to take WALLET_ROOT effect. If you want to encrypt your tables with AES256 then you must specify the encryption type in the command as follows, To check the columns that have been encrypted run this query. (DIRECTORY=$ORACLE_BASE/admin/$ORACLE_SID/wallet))). You do not need to set the encryption key using the command ALTER SYSTEM set encryption key. TDE is part of Oracle Advanced Security, which also includes Data Redaction. Change), You are commenting using your Facebook account. We should make sure the environment before doing it. A simple copy from the node 1 can make this. An example of data being processed may be a unique identifier stored in a cookie. Oracle 19c | How to configure TDE on Oracle 19c Standalone Database in Now use the OS strings command to determine whether the string value inserted in the table is visible: SQL> !strings /u02/app/oracle/oradata/ORADBWR/tde_tbs1.dbf | grep GSMB Database downtime is limited to the time it takes to perform Data Guard switch over. In a multitenant environment, you can configure keystores for either the entire container database (CDB) or for individual pluggable databases (PDBs). Configuring Transparent Data Encryption In Oracle 19c Database For example, Exadata Smart Scans parallelize cryptographic processing across multiple storage cells, resulting in faster queries on encrypted data.
Georgia Most Wanted 2021,
Drizzt Do'urden Official Stats 5e,
Washington Resale Certificate,
Dewalt Vs Milwaukee Cordless Framing Nailer,
Lords Mobile Player Finder,
Articles T